Which J-Web tab do you use to add licenses to the device?

The correct answer is D. "Maintain". The 'Maintain' tab in the J-Web interface is used for managing device upkeep tasks, including adding licenses.

Why each option

The 'Maintain' tab in the J-Web interface is used for managing device upkeep tasks, including adding licenses.

A"Configure"

The 'Configure' tab is primarily for changing operational settings and parameters of the device, not for adding licenses.

B"Troubleshoot"

The 'Troubleshoot' tab is used for diagnosing and resolving issues, not for administrative tasks like license installation.

C"Monitor"

The 'Monitor' tab is used for viewing real-time data, logs, and statistics about device operation, not for configuration or maintenance tasks.

D"Maintain"Correct

The 'Maintain' tab in J-Web provides functions related to device maintenance, which typically includes tasks such as software upgrades, backups, reboots, and license management, making it the correct location to add licenses.
